随着互联网技术的迅速发展,网页的无障碍性问题引起了越来越多的关注。在实现无障碍功能的同时,如何保证页面的性能也是很重要的。本文将会介绍无障碍性能问题中的性能指标及分析方法,并提供示例代码进行实践。
无障碍性能问题
在网页中,无障碍性(Accessibility)是指让残障人士和老年人能够方便地获取和使用网页内容的一种特性。无障碍性并不仅仅是一种web标准,更是应该成为每个网页设计的基本准则。无障碍性是一个综合性的问题,包括多个方面,如可用性、可读性、可视性等等。
然而,在实现无障碍性的同时,我们还要保证页面的性能。这是一种平衡的考量,我们需要在保证无障碍性的条件下尽量提高页面的性能。
性能指标
无障碍性能问题的性能指标可以从以下方面考虑:
加载时间
对于残障人群来说,加载时间是一个很关键的问题。如果网页加载时间过长,残障人士很可能会放弃访问这个网页。因此,我们必须要确保在保障无障碍的前提下尽量缩短网页的加载时间。
响应时间
响应时间也是一个很关键的指标。如果一个残障人士在页面上进行了操作,但页面无法立即响应,这会对用户体验产生负面影响。特别是对于一些视力或听力障碍的残障人士,响应时间需要更加关注。
可用性
无障碍性能问题的终极目标是让所有人都能够顺畅地使用网页。因此,可用性也是一个很重要的考虑因素。我们需要确保网页的内容、功能和操作都能够给残障人士提供便利和依据。
兼容性
因为残障人群往往使用的是助听设备和辅助功能设备,所以网页的兼容性也是一个非常重要的指标。我们应该确保网页能够在各种设备和系统上正常运行,并给残障人群带来方便。
分析方法
了解了无障碍性能问题的性能指标之后,我们还需要一些分析方式来评估网页的性能。以下是几种比较常用的分析方式:
评分卡
评分卡是一种将多个指标综合评估的工具。我们可以将每个指标的重要性进行打分,并计算评分卡的总分。评分卡可以帮助我们更加客观地评估网页的性能和无障碍性。
网络性能分析工具
网络性能分析工具可以帮助我们分析网页的加载时间和响应时间,并提供具体的优化建议。同时,这类工具也可以帮助我们分析网页的兼容性和可用性。
用户测试
用户测试是一种比较直接的评估方式。我们可以邀请残障人群体验网页,并收集他们的反馈。这种方式可以帮助我们更真实地了解网页的无障碍性能,并提供改进的建议。
示例代码
最后,为了让大家更好地了解本文所涉及的内容,我们提供一些无障碍性能问题的示例代码,供大家参考和实践。
-- -------------------- ---- ------- ---- -------- --- ---- ----------------- -------------- -- ---- -------- --- ------- ------ - -------- --- ----- ----- - -------- ---- ------- --- ---- ----------------------- ------------------- ---- ----------------------- -------------------- ------ -------- ------------------ ------------------ --------
结论
通过本文的介绍,我们了解了无障碍性能问题的性能指标、分析方法和示例代码。在实现无障碍性功能的同时,我们也需要确保网页的性能,并考虑到残障人士的需求和使用习惯。我们希望这篇文章可以对大家有所启示,为大家的web开发工作带来一些帮助。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/6703c110d91dce0dc84c8130